The World Is A'Changing

This world is always changing and has always been.
Just since I came, not even one hundred years before, every trend
Is always making way for some other unsung trend.
In a positive note, it is called "progress" where more will win

Than lose! Other eras have been hit hard when life was like an unpunished sin.
I do believe, however, that there has, in this interval, most certainly been
An epic of discovery on every level that mankind may push the frontiers to their limit
And open up a whole new world. Our golden opportunity, the invasive epidemic

Of all great knowledge and wisdom. Don't miss this chance
To experience a whole new world with you participating. Be warned in advance.
Buckle up for the ride of your life and whatever you do,
Don't you dare "blow it" for the world and all of us are counting on you.

Lucile I. Burke
June 28, 1997
